Role : Fire Safety Consultant
Location: London
Salary: £40,000 – £50,000 + company car or allowance

Are you a fire safety professional with experience in risk assessments and a passion for delivering high-quality consultancy? Technical Resources are recruiting for a Fire Safety Consultant to join a respected fire safety consultancy based in the South. You’ll be working across a diverse portfolio of clients, commercial, residential, and complex properties, carrying out assessments and providing clear, actionable advice.

Responsibilities :

● Conduct fire risk assessments in accordance with the Regulatory Reform (Fire Safety) Order 2005
● Produce detailed fire safety reports and action plans using internal tools and MS Word
● Offer practical, tailored fire safety advice to clients and stakeholders
● Work directly with FMs, landlords, surveyors, and fire services to develop or review fire safety strategies
● Attend client meetings and act as a trusted fire safety advisor
● Maintain up-to-date CPD and monitor changes in fire safety legislation and best practice
● Carry out assessments on both commercial and complex residential buildings
● Represent the company with professionalism and uphold health & safety standards

Experience and Certifications Required:

● Minimum of 2–3 years' experience conducting fire risk assessments
● Level 2/3 Fire Risk Assessment qualification (IFE, FPA, IFSM or equivalent preferred)
● Membership of IFE or IFSM (preferred)
● Ideally, registered with a third-party accreditation scheme (e.g. IFE Register – or working towards)
● Sound knowledge of UK fire safety legislation and protection systems
● Strong technical report writing skills
● Understanding of active and passive fire protection
● Excellent communication skills – written and verbal
● Proficient with MS Office and digital reporting tools
● Ability to work independently and manage your own schedule
